We’re thrilled to announce that BIOS, our new AI Scientist, just ranked as the best-performing agent for biological data analysis. This is a big accomplishment for our up-and-coming AI for Science lab. We've published a paper detailing the BIOS architecture and pushing the AI Scientist live for researchers to use. BIOS hit #1 on BixBench benchmark (all modes): • 48.78% open-answer • 55.12% multiple-choice + refusal • 64.39% multiple-choice (no refusal) Ahead of leading Agentic Science systems like Edison, K-Dense and Kepler. Beyond its raw performance, BIOS is built to speed up scientific iteration by introducing human-in-the-loop checkpoints that let researchers steer investigations mid-flight as insights emerge. This stands in contrast to the batch-processing modes of existing AI Scientists, which allow for human oversight only after time and compute-intensive runs finish - often forcing full reruns to explore new directions. BIOS, on the other hand, is designed to speed up science by slowing down: it adds checkpoints at key decision points, so humans can adapt research trajectories in-session and respond to intermediate findings. No more waiting hours for batch runs + reruns. 4 specialized agents power the system: • Orchestrator Agent: breaks complex problems into actionable steps, routes them to the right specialist agents, and queues the chosen next steps. • Literature Agent: searches + synthesizes across papers, patents, clinical trials, and scientific databases (ArXiv, PubMed, CrossRef, Semantic Scholar, Google Scholar, etc.) • Data Analysis Agent: autonomously writes and runs Python to analyze datasets, produce figures, and report quantified findings. • Novelty Detection Agent: checks whether proposed hypotheses have been previously investigated You can run BIOS in semi-autonomous mode with checkpoints or fully autonomous mode for your deep research task to run without interruption until completion. Either way, you stay in control of the research direction. BIOS is built on top of BioAgents, our open-source framework for building scientific agents. In the future, BIOS can eventually provide the orchestration layer that coordinates specialized subagents. The core infrastructure of the BioAgents framework is public, and we welcome researchers and developers to build their own scientific agents or subagents, or contribute to ours. The Literature and Data Analysis agents are not yet open source, but we're working on providing API access in the near future. Locomotion Beyond Feet is an egocentric hierarchical system that combines reference motion keyframes, reinforcement learning–based motion retargeting, and depth-based, vision-guided skill planning to achieve zero-shot sim-to-real transfer across diverse extreme terrains. 2/7
